N egative pressure wound therapy (NPWT) is a well-established treatment option for the management of a range of chronic and acute wounds. 1 NPWT is believed to contribute to wound healing through a number of mechanisms, including drainage of excess exudate, reduction of edema, and removing barriers to cell migration …
WebIndeed, NPWT is valuable in treating acute, sub-acute and chronic wounds of various sizes and depths. This therapy is of utmost importance in diabetic foot ulcers in which fast wound closure is equivalent to limb preservation. Negative pressure involves an open cell foam or gauze dressing that one applies to the wound base.
